Posted: Sun Jul 31, 2011 8:28 am    Post subject: Marquee 8000 no menu on green

I am in the process of upgrading my Electrohome Marquee 8000 to a 8500

i bought the Marquee HD Mods by Draganm + a set of new Focus coils with Stig board etc.


i have fitted everything ok but i get no menu on green??

The menu works fine with the red tube on only or the blue tube on only but is not working with the green tube on only.

All i get is a black solid box where the menu should be??

Posted: Sun Jul 31, 2011 2:06 pm    Post subject:

I agree with Tim, you can't ever really modify an 8000 to an 8500, the CLM, backplane, etc will still be an 8000.

Do keep an eye out for an 8500 chassis. As for your no green issues, you have a bad neck board, no G2 voltage going to the green tube, or a bad video input board. Swap the green video cable on the video input board with the red, and see if the green menu then comes up on the red tube. Do you get green video on the green tube, and is it just the menus that are missing, or is the green tube completely dead?

Curt I'm going to politely disagree Wink . The backplance and Mobo were essentially the same between late 1994 and late middle of 1997. that's why they had that crappy little adapter to the ribbon cables and the insulating strip that was left over from the fixed rear heat-sink. The mobo wasn't re-designed unti late 1997 just prior to the Ultra when they put in a proper Ribbon cable socket's and got rid of the jumper wires. It's also why E-home was able to use up the remainder of the old 8000 boards in 1995 by installing them in the early 8110. The early 8110's had all sorts of old 8000 parts in them including neck-cards, VIM's and power supply's.
If 8500 chassis's were readily available in the UK I would have none the less recommended that route simply to get the 34.9KV HVPS. However that wasn't an option and even if it were it would have required an additional $120. postage to ship those 8500 boards overseas to me first.
In short, If I felt that the parts I sent were unable to bring Sarah's chassis up to a full 8500, or there was a cheaper or easier alternative, I would not have recommended this route.

as in my e-mail this morning, the set should have done a complete re-initialization after you installed the new CLM? Since the chassis went from V2.0 to V3.4 it's necessary for the chip on the backplane which records things like model number and total hours to re-establish a fresh hand-shake with with the main U34 software chip.
If the set did not completely re-set itself then that needs to happen . It's under utility's menu, service, pass-code 0901, "set initialization- re-set everything.
prior to re-set , You can use Marquee librarian to save your old settings from the RS232 port then re-load them afterwards.

Sarah I am also looking forward to your impressions of the pic quality post mod's. Remember that everything including tube color temps D6500K, Individual tube EM focus, stig, Flare, contrast , brightness, etc. will need to be re-done. Also, After the VDC "line fix" tech bulletin I have found that source brightness needs to be lowered as well as PJ brightness (down to about 30) in order to get good Black levels.

Last but lot least for anyone reading this down the road, In my HD mod's instructions I specifically ask people to do this in well lighted place when your well rested and to take a break after a few hours. 3AM to replace almost every board in a chassis is something I would fine challenging and I can work on these almost blindfolded.
Luckily it seems like there were no major errors during re-assembly and the tubes and boards are safe.

Backplane issues are starting to pop up now, not common but possible considering their 15+ years old. I use to just send them to recycling when I cannibalized a chassis but I'll keep one or 2 here just in case.

Sarah's machine on last report is fine, reversed R + B connectors on VIM and FCM, so menu's are green now and the stig works. Easy to do, I know I've done it out in the garage more than once.
